Winning the Bundesliga has been a walk in the park for Bayern Munich this season. They lead all opposition by an astonishing 20 points. Dortmund have had a solid campaign in the league but not nearly as impressive as Bayern.


Bayern have not only excelled in the league, but their results in the Champions League have also been extraordinary. Bayern Munich knocked out former Champions League favourites Barcelona, wiping the floor with them in the process.


Following a 4-0 thrashing, some believed it was possible for the Spanish giants to make a magnificent comeback at the Camp Nou in order to reach the final. Instead, Bayern performed just as majestically as they did in the first leg and beat them 3-0.


Overall, the aggregate score was 7-0 to Bayern Munich. This sort of result is rare for an incredible Barcelona team, but Bayern went the extra mile. They are desperate to win what they came so close to winning last year. The delicate and exquisite footwork and pace of Arjen Robben annihilated Barcelona. I'm sure he will be hoping to do the same to Dortmund too.


Bayern definitely have the potential to be crowned Europe's top team. They had the potential last year but failed to do what was needed. Will they use last year's heartache to spur them on this year?


Borussia Dortmund are a superb side built off of youthful prodigies and breathtaking teamwork. Although they have not performed as well in the Bundesliga, they have been terrific in all stages of the Champions League.


Like Bayern, Dortmund managed to eliminate a very difficult semi-final opponent in style. Cristiano Ronaldo and Real Madrid fought back at the Bernabeu, but could not complete the comeback needed to outclass the 4-1 victory Lewandowski provided on German soil.


Up until the second leg of the semi-final, Borussia Dortmund were undefeated. Using their young and ambitious stars, they managed to pull off exceptional performances in every stage of the competition. Marcos Reus, Mari Gotze and Lewandowski are the most well-known of the Dortmund squad, but every player has played their part in what has been a remarkable campaign.


Bayern Munich are going to have to been on top form to defeat this determined side. The last time the two played, the result was 1-1. Borussia Dortmund have only reached the final once before, and they won. Will they go two for two?


As Lionel Messi and Ronaldo stay at home to watch the final, the two best teams in Germany will fight relentlessly until the final whistle. Both teams could pull off that magical Champions League performance in order to win it all.
